Q: What is Bothriospondylus?


A: Bothriospondylus is a genus of sauropodomorph dinosaur known from a few vertebrae.

Q: Who coined the family Bothriospondylidae?


A: Richard Lydekker coined the family Bothriospondylidae in 1885.

Q: What is the specimen BMNH R44529-5?


A: The genus Bothriospondylus is based on the specimen BMNH R44529-5.

Q: How many vertebrae were used to identify Bothriospondylus?


A: A handful of vertebrae were used to identify Bothriospondylus.

Q: What is the meaning of Bothriospondylus?


A: The name Bothriospondylus means 'excavated vertebrae'.

Q: What type of dinosaur is Bothriospondylus?


A: Bothriospondylus is a sauropodomorph dinosaur.

Q: How well-known is Bothriospondylus?


A: Bothriospondylus is not very well-known due to the very limited number of fossils available.
